4109 P-L. Discovered 1960 Sept. 24 by C. J. van Houten and I. van Houten-Groeneveld at Palomar.

Named in honor of Bernhard Schmidt (1879–1935), the inventor of the Schmidt telescope. (M 3086)

This name has been proposed by Dr. Paul Herget.

A description of his life and work appeared in Sky Telesc., November 1955. Schmidt is also honored by a lunar crater.
